There is knockoffs of knockoffs of knockoffs and there might be a knockoff to that! Ive seen at least 3 differant knockoffs of the GAB wheels, Ive owned the GT3s.


I have not seen the same rota vs drag wheel side by side but they look very close. I think the color might be a hair off from a rota to a drag. I had a set of GT3s the paint was very durable and my friend with gold drags are also holding up well. I had a set of Rota JSPLs and the paint and clear on the lips were just starting to chip a little only after 2 1/2 years with useing no harsh cleaners and only one winter. I just bought a set of used SSK wheels and the finish seems very cheap. Drag and Rota have a better finish then the SSK just for your info.
